What the Hell Just Happened

Live every day to the fullest Each one is a treasure that cannot be recaptured Life has a beginning, a middle, and an end No second chance to experience things for the very first time Make the most of every day Breathe in deeply the breath of life Remember the joys of discovering new things as a child Your heart throbbing first romance as a teen The night you announce you're going steady The union of two souls as you marry That scary time when your first child is born Suddenly you realize you are not young anymore Don't let life and love pass you by It is meant to be lived to the fullest Before you can turn around You're sitting in a comfortable old easy chair Wondering... “What the hell just happened!” Life just happened! © Jack Ellison 2014
